One lane open towards Montreal on the Île-aux-Tourtes bridge this weekend
The ministère des Transports et de la Mobilité durable wishes to inform the public that continued maintenance work on the Île-aux-Tourtes bridge will result in additional traffic congestion over the weekend of August 11 to 14.
From Friday evening to Monday morning, two lanes will be available towards Vaudreuil-Dorion and one towards Montreal.
Traffic management
On Highway 40, between Vaudreuil-Dorion and Senneville:
- From Friday, August 11, 10 p.m. to Monday, August 14, 5 a.m.: two westbound lanes (towards Vaudreuil-Dorion) and one eastbound lane (towards Montreal) maintained;
- From 5 a.m. on Monday, August 14: two lanes in each direction;
Episodes of congestion are to be expected. A police presence, increased signage and coordination with other nearby worksites are planned to limit the impact on traffic, but the Ministry recommends that road users who will have to travel in the area allow extra time to reach their destination.
This hindrance, required for the concreting of edge beams, could be cancelled due to unfavorable weather conditions or operational constraints. Therefore, before taking to the road, we recommend that you consult Québec 511, a practical tool to help you plan your travel.
